UPDATE: State Road 1 Closed At Cook Road Due To Semi Crash

The road will remain closed into the evening hours.

Shutterstock photo

Update published at 5:40 p.m.: 

According to INDOT, State Road 1 will be closed for several more hours as crews work to clear the earlier accident. 

The closure is between Sawdon Ridge Road and North Dearborn Road. 

 

Original story published at 1:56 p.m.:

(Guilford, Ind.) - State Road 1 is closed near Guilford. 

An accident was reported near Cook Road around 12:35 p.m.

A semi reportedly overturned and went down an embankment, stopping approximately 100 feet from the road.

The driver was extricated from the vehicle and transported to an area hospital with minor injuries. 

Dearborn County Dispatch says State Road 1 is closed at Cook Road until further notice.
